Output ab588ce270872d19ff990025d06576f56896230ef99f48e7d94e19a1ea8e3784:2

value
353049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e1df74e73d0cac37383483afea132f16c7d6ef OP_EQUAL
address
34bbTQv8YR5NGY5V4KzjorKKhRrTPJFqpx
transaction
ab588ce270872d19ff990025d06576f56896230ef99f48e7d94e19a1ea8e3784
spent
true